Accidents happen during most of the shooting. Only at Bond is opened by the press a large barrel. OK. The expectations of the new film are high. Especially after the hiccup with the change of director, the unfinished script, etc.
In order for the articles to get more "clicks", the DM had even put the rumor in the headline:
"... Cary Fukunage has quit. ..."
I remember that CR partly in a Prague
Film Studio was filmed because the 007 Stage was burned down. The final scenes in the Venzian Palazzo were again filmed in the newly constructed 007 Stage. Thus, the large water tank was available, which made it possible to build a hydraulically lowerable set.
Ultimately, there are professionals at work and they will hopefully deliver us an ingenious Bondfim.
